Systematic Study of Pyroelectricity. Applications of Pyroelectric Materials

Full accounts are given of theoretical and experimental studies of ferroelectric phase transitions begun under a previous contract and completed under the present one. The findings of these studies are applied to the analysis of several applications of pyroelectric materials and to the evaluation of the suitability of various ferroelectrics for these uses. A major result is that improper ferroelectrics, in which the polarization is not the order parameter, are predicted to have performance superior to that of proper ferroelectrics in both infrared imaging and thermal-to-electrical energy conversion applications. Experimental evidence is presented supporting this conclusion in the case of the pyroelectric vidicon. (Author)
